Veneration of the Blessed Mother


MANILA, Philippines - Thirty-six years ago, the Catholic Bishops' Conference of the Philippines published a pastoral letter on the Blessed Virgin Mary entitled Ang Mahal na Birhen: Mary in Philippine Life Today. Devotion to Mary, according to this document, "is the safeguard for the preservation of our faith and the principle of deeper and fuller evangelization."But it also cautions against some aspects of Marian devotion that have strayed from genuineness and purity, and hence are in need of reform and renewal.
